About the Book



"We all experience wilderness seasons-times in our lives when we feel lost, confused, and alone. In this 6-week study, Kristel Acevedo helps us reflect on our metaphorical wilderness seasons by pointing us to biblical figures who experienced a physical wilderness: John the Baptist, Hagar, the Israelites, Elijah, Adam and Eve, and Jesus. By drawing connections to the wilderness experiences of these individuals, Kristel helps us see that it's often in these seasons of darkness and loss that God meets us, God makes himself known to us, and that God uses it to transform us and renew our minds. Without dismissing the ache of these wilderness seasons-because we would never choose these painful experiences-Kristel reminded us that it's in these valleys of life that we learn to rely on God and his strength"--



Book Synopsis



Finding Direction in Times of Uncertainty

In the tumultuous journeys of life, there are moments that leave you feeling disconnected, lost, hurt, confused, and wondering where God is. A Way in the Wilderness by Kristel Acevedo offers a six-week Bible study designed for individuals or groups of any size, encouraging you that in those seasons of wilderness, God is with you.

Each week, Kristel leads readers through reflections on a biblical figure who faced their own wilderness--from the solitude of John the Baptist to the trials of the Israelites. Through these familiar stories, she draws parallels to life now, helping you see that amidst the struggles is often where God meets you most profoundly.

  • Learn from the story of John the Baptist how strength in the wilderness comes from God, not yourself
  • Experience alongside Hagar how God still sees and cares even though the world is broken
  • See through the story of Adam and Eve how God covers your sins in Christ's righteousness and offers hope for restoration in the midst of the wilderness
  • Reflect on the journey of the Israelites and the importance of keeping your focus on God
  • Delve into the life of Elijah to understand how God meets you even in the depths of despair
  • Through studying Jesus's experience, learn how the scriptures provide guidance to help you through the wilderness

Six weekly online teaching videos enhance your study, offering deeper insights. Whether you've felt the sting of isolation, the ache of lost direction, or the shadows of despair, A Way in the Wilderness will remind you that while you might not choose these experiences, they are opportunities for growth and reliance on a strength greater than your own.

Available in both English and Spanish, A Way in the Wilderness offers an invitation to meet God in the wilderness and to allow him to grow and transform you through it.

About the Author



Kristel Acevedo (MA, Southeastern Seminary) is the discipleship director at Transformation Church, a vibrant multiethnic and multigenerational community near Charlotte, North Carolina. Originally from Miami and the daughter of immigrants, she has a passion for discipleship, biblical literacy, multiethnic ministry, and helping others develop a biblical view on immigration. Kristel is a coauthor of 3 Big Questions That Shape Your Future.
